Material Costs - Hardwood siding typically costs between $3 to $8 per square foot for materials, depending on the type of wood chosen. For example, premium hardwoods like mahogany can be on the higher end of the range, while standard oak may be more affordable. Material costs vary based on quality and supplier pricing.
Labor Expenses - Installation labor usually ranges from $2 to $6 per square foot, influenced by the complexity of the project and local labor rates. Larger or more intricate installations tend to increase overall costs. Labor costs can account for a significant portion of the total project budget.
Additional Costs - Extra expenses may include surface preparation, removal of existing siding, or finishing work, which can add $1 to $3 per square foot. These costs vary depending on the condition of the existing structure and desired finish quality. Budgeting for these extras ensures a comprehensive cost estimate.
Project Size Impact - Larger siding projects typically benefit from volume discounts, but overall costs depend on the total square footage. For example, a 500-square-foot installation might range from $3,500 to $8,500 in total costs. Contact local pros for tailored estimates based on specific project sizes.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is hardwood siding installation? Hardwood siding installation involves attaching durable wood panels to the exterior of a building to enhance its appearance and protect it from the elements.
How long does hardwood siding typically last? The lifespan of hardwood siding varies depending on maintenance and climate, but it can often last several decades with proper care.
Are there different styles of hardwood siding available? Yes, hardwood siding comes in various styles, including horizontal planks, shingles, and board-and-batten, to suit different aesthetic preferences.
What should I consider before choosing hardwood siding? Factors to consider include the local climate, maintenance requirements, and the architectural style of the property.
